We were sent to Bristol Heart Centre from Cheltenham in the early hours of Thursday. After seeing the consultant an ambulance was ordered at 9. 30 am for the return journey. After waiting 4 hours the staff were told it was thought the transport was required for 10pm. At 2pm we were told the next available transport was a private ambulance at 5pm. This arrived after 6pm having just come in from Cardiff with a sick baby. All the while I could see other ambulances parked up outside the Heart Centre. It was not good for the patient having to monitor their BM's and eat accordingly ready for the journey.
